Mechanical waves can't pass through... roofer facebook advertisingWebLongitudinal waves can be transmitted through all the three types of media, that is solids, liquids and gases. Longitudinal waves travel in the form of alternate compressions and rarefactions. Material medium is essential for transmission of longitudinal waves. Longitudinal waves cannot be polarized. roofer facilities databaseWebWaves are actually energy passing through the water, causing it to move in a circular motion.
